A good line output converter takes speaker-level audio and turns it into clean RCA preamp output. From there, reliability matters just as much as sound quality—especially how the converter handles your vehicle’s power and signal quirks. Active converters are often a better bet because they include a built-in line driver for stronger, more consistent output to downstream amps. If you’re chasing bass, look for bass compensation features, because many factory systems roll off low frequencies as volume rises. And for noise-free operation, turn-on method matters: you want a converter that wakes up your amplifier consistently, not one that causes pops or delays. What to Look For Before Buying

The best line output converter has to match what your factory system is actually doing and then reliably power your amplifier. I’d focus first on conversion quality plus real control features—gain adjustment, bass correction, and anything that helps prevent clipping. Next, pay attention to turn-on behavior, especially in modern vehicles where simple sensing can create noise, delays, or inconsistent wake-ups. Finally, check how it fits your install (mounting space, cable routing) and whether you need anything beyond basic conversion—like load matching—for factory amplified systems.

Check Match turn-on strategy to the vehicle

Match the turn-on strategy to the vehicle. Turn-on methods can include DC offset sensing, audio sensing, Great Turn On (GTO) approaches, or a straight remote 12V trigger. Pick the method that best matches how your factory radio outputs behave, because that’s what reduces pops and misfires. If your vehicle output varies with DSP modes or changes at low volume, sensing-based converters can act inconsistently. In those cases, I’d look for a converter with selectable turn-on options so you can adapt without redesigning the install.

Value Prioritize bass correction when factory bass rolls off

Prioritize bass correction when factory bass rolls off. Many OEM systems reduce low-end as you turn the volume up, so plain gain sometimes just makes thin bass louder. Features like BassLift or AccuBASS target that perceived bass drop. If your main goal is more sub impact, bass correction usually matters more than relying on the amplifier’s EQ alone. If you plan to use an external DSP, bass correction may still help—just confirm how your signal routing will interact with the rest of the processing.

Rating Use measurable specs to judge performance

Use measurable specs to judge performance. When the listing includes frequency response ranges and power handling, it’s easier to predict whether the converter will stay clean at your listening levels. An input limit is also useful—if it’s too low for your OEM power behavior, clipping becomes more likely. An LED clipping indicator is especially practical because it helps you avoid setup mistakes during gain staging. If key specs are missing, I’d treat the unit as a budget bet and validate with real audio results once installed.

Verify Confirm integration needs like load matching and fader behavior

Confirm integration needs like load matching and fader behavior. Factory amplified systems can detect unexpected speaker impedance or missing loads and then protect or mute. AudioControl’s impedance-switch approach is a good example of how some converters address that. I’d also check multi-amp behavior and whether the system retains fader control if you’re planning multiple downstream amplifiers. Finally, a compact chassis and included remote knob can make tuning simpler—especially if the converter won’t be easy to reach after installation.

Frequently Asked Questions

What does a line output converter actually do?

A line output converter takes speaker-level audio signals and turns them into low-level RCA preamp signals. This lets aftermarket amplifiers accept factory audio without replacing the head unit. Many converters also create an amp turn-on signal using methods like DC offset, audio sensing, or relay logic. More advanced models may add bass restoration and/or load matching to better handle OEM stability.

Why does turn-on reliability matter with a line output converter?

Turn-on reliability matters because a bad trigger can cause loud pops, delayed amplifier wake-up, or even random shutoffs. The behavior depends on how the converter senses the signal or power state—DC offset and Great Turn On approaches are often built to be more stable. If your vehicle uses variable output levels, DSP processing, or changes signal behavior at different volumes, selectable turn-on options can reduce setup risk.

Do all line output converters include bass controls or correction?

No. Some line output converters only provide speaker-to-RCA conversion plus gain adjustment. Others include bass correction technologies such as BassLift or AccuBASS to counter factory bass roll-off. Some also offer bass controls or low-pass outputs for subwoofer-focused routing. If bass correction matters for your goals, I’d pick a model with that feature rather than relying only on your amplifier EQ.

Is active conversion better than passive conversion?

Active converters include a line driver that can provide stronger, cleaner signal conditioning—especially helpful with longer RCA runs or amplifiers that need a stable input level. Active units often deliver more consistent output across volume changes. That said, whether active is “better” depends on your vehicle and what your downstream amplifier actually requires.

When is load matching needed for a factory amplified system?

Load matching is most important when factory amplifiers detect unexpected speaker impedance or missing loads and then enter protection or mute behavior. Simple LOCs can work fine with non-amplified head units, but amplified OEM systems may react differently. Converters that include selectable impedance options are built to address this directly. I’d confirm what kind of factory amplification your vehicle has before installing, since it affects how likely you are to run into dropouts.
